Mention has been made about Marriott taking over, and I admit to be a great fan of Marriott properties, and I see that they have invested in staff and food. The menu is more extensive than at The House, but does not have the same variety. Postiano's is next to The House and serves very good Italian food. If you like to visit other Marriott property restaurants, you can. I love crab cakes, and had them three times, but each rendition was different. We stayed for 10 days and didn't have the same lunch or dinner twice the whole time. Your menu will include local dishes mixed with old favorites. One writer complained about the inedible steak, but I had the best filet mignon ever. This was our first experience at an all-inclusive resort, and we were so impressed! The staff is outstanding. Our room was comfortable, with a nice balcony and modern bathroom, great mattress and a wine refrigerator. ![]() We were in a small room overlooking the beach, but I know there are other room arrangements. I love the Spanish style architecture and the great open area that serves as a restaurant or lounging area right up to the beach, which has experienced some erosion, but is still lovely. ![]() ![]()
